Output ec66ee87914f4d79e7671d88c52acfec8eb2e740568315bf41f778926bebc65c:1

value
1645061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45aa93693054cdd364f436dd7d7f49ec115abc98 OP_EQUAL
address
383NtbXRU98i1fVsX8qEs7sNMFqYbgEQP5
transaction
ec66ee87914f4d79e7671d88c52acfec8eb2e740568315bf41f778926bebc65c
spent
true